NEW WAYS OF BEING IN RELATIONSHIPS

Open Talks | FRIDAY 24 APRIL 2020

Social distancing and domestic segregation allow us to appreciate the value of relationships and to experience different ways of being in relationship, with ourselves, with our loved ones, with colleagues, with the context. Dilemmas emerge around which to question and confront ourselves.

With Silvia Roà, Don Gino Rigoldi, Marco Meschini, Annalaura Perfetto
Coordinator: Andrea Volpe, Marina Maderna
